Determination of the domain of the admissible matrix elements in the four-dimensional PT-symmetric anharmonic model
Abstract
Many manifestly non-Hermitian Hamiltonians (typically, PT-symmetric complex anharmonic oscillators) possess a strictly real, "physical" bound-state spectrum. This means that they are (quasi-)Hermitian with respect to a suitable non-standard metric. The domain D of the existence of this metric is studied here for a nontrivial though still non-numerical four-parametric "benchmark" matrix model.
